About this poster

The skier in this chalk-drawn design by Carigiet gives a winning cheer in the Olympic Winter Games of 1948 in St. Moritz. Carigiet’s commercial art style was based on observations of nature and mixed with the traditional elements popular at the time, as this poster shows.

Artist: Alois Carigiet

The graphic designer, painter and illustrator Alois Carigiet was born in Trun (Grisons) in 1902 and came to Chur with his family in 1911. After finishing an apprenticeship as a stage painter in Chur, he went to work for a renowned graphic design studio in Zurich from 1923 to 1927.
